55PLUS is a men's organization in Princeton, NJ which meets twice a month except during the summer to meet socially, attend lectures on interesting topics and to involve themselves in a variety of other community activities. It was organized in 1986 as a non-sectarian group to promote social contacts and friendships among men who were either retired or had flexible working hours. In 2007 it was 21 years old.
